In animal kingdom up to Cephlochordata(or Acrania) spinal cord is not present but from Vertebrata(or Craniata) spinal cord present that mean if we go developed animal after Vertebrata all have spine.
Like Vertebrata has divided into two super class i)Agnatha ii) Gnathostomata
and in this Gnathostomata super-class Fish,Amphibia,Reptilia ,Aves, Mammalia all belongs so all have spine.

Actually Chordata has divided into four sub part Hemichordata Urochordata, Cephalochordata and Vertebrata
Among four only Vertebrata has spine.
Now why ?
Because in chordata class animal we find two type of organ one called i)Notochord ii) Nerve cord
this notochord has developed into spine due to evolution
